Abdulhadi Eissa Omran is a professor in the Faculty of Medicine, at Al-Azhar University in Egypt.
He has done many contributions to the world of psychiatry and gave lectures concerning depression, OCD (Obsessive Compulsive Disorder) and other mental illnesses in countries all over the world.
He attended Psychiatric Conferences in Paris, Amsterdam, Dubai, Sweden and Bahrain.
Later in 1996, he earned a 6 months-course scholarship to Johns Hopkins School of Medicine in Baltimore, Maryland in his course for gaining an MD degree.
He reached the rank of a professor of psychiatry in Al-Azhar University in 2007 and is currently teaching the post graduates and senior students.
